The main differences lie in the pacing and sometimes the emphasis on certain plot points. The manga might have more depth in character development that the anime doesn't fully capture. Also, some visual elements could be presented differently.
Well, the Seikon no Qwaser manga and its anime adaptation differ in how they present the action scenes. The manga might have more elaborate panels, while the anime might use animation techniques to create a different visual impact. Additionally, the anime could leave out some minor plot points present in the manga.
